Abstract
Let $f$ be analytic in the unit disk $\mathbb D$ and normalized so that
$f(z)=z+a_2z^2+a_3z^3+\cdots$. In this paper, we give upper bounds of the
Hankel determinant of second order for the classes of starlike functions of
order $\alpha$, Ozaki close-to-convex functions and two other classes of
analytic functions. Some of the estimates are sharp.
